A company runs Vault Enterprise in a primary data center and serves applications from multiple geographic regions. Users in Europe report high latency during read-heavy operations such as token validation and secret reads, while security leadership also requires a warm standby environment that can be promoted if the primary data center becomes unavailable. Which replication design best meets both requirements?

  1. A

    Configure performance replication for regional clusters to serve local read requests, and configure a disaster recovery secondary in the standby data center for failover promotion if the primary is lost.

  2. B

    Configure only disaster recovery replication in each region, because disaster recovery secondaries can actively serve application traffic and also be promoted during an outage.

  3. C

    Configure performance replication only, because performance secondaries can be promoted for disaster recovery and eliminate the need for a separate standby environment.

  4. D

    Configure Vault Agent caching in each region instead of replication, because caching provides both cross-region failover and authoritative copies of Vault data.

Correct answer: A

Explanation

The key distinction is purpose: performance replication is for scale and locality of access, especially in geographically distributed environments, while disaster recovery replication is for business continuity and failover. In real deployments, organizations often use performance replication to place secondary clusters near users or applications to reduce latency for read-heavy workloads, and separately use DR replication to maintain a warm standby cluster in another site or region. HashiCorp documentation describes performance replication as supporting horizontal scaling and local reads, while DR replication maintains a secondary that can be promoted if the primary cluster is unavailable. For this scenario, the only option that satisfies both the operational performance goal and the recovery requirement is to use both replication types for their intended purposes.

  • A. Correct.

    Correct. Performance replication is used to scale read traffic and reduce latency by placing performance secondary clusters closer to clients. Disaster recovery (DR) replication is used to maintain a warm standby copy of the Vault cluster that can be promoted if the primary cluster fails. This combination addresses both business needs: better regional read performance and an outage recovery strategy.

  • B. Incorrect.

    Incorrect. This reflects a common misconception. DR secondaries are not intended to serve normal application traffic the way performance secondaries do. Their purpose is to maintain a replicated standby cluster for recovery and promotion during a disaster event. Using only DR replication would not solve the read-scaling and low-latency regional access requirement.

  • C. Incorrect.

    Incorrect. Performance replication improves scale and locality for requests, but it is not the same as disaster recovery replication. Although performance replication supports replicated clusters, the exam objective distinguishes DR replication as the feature specifically used to maintain a recoverable standby environment for failover. Relying only on performance replication does not best satisfy the explicit requirement for a warm standby DR design.

  • D. Incorrect.

    Incorrect. Vault Agent caching can reduce repeated requests to Vault and improve application performance in some patterns, but it is not a replication mechanism. It does not create an authoritative standby cluster and cannot be promoted during a data center outage. This option confuses client-side optimization with server-side replication capabilities.
